Marine MONTAGUE HAROLD BLAKE

Service Number: PLY/19403
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Royal Marines

Date of Death

Died 08 December 1942

Age 44 years old

Buried or commemorated at

PLYMOUTH (WESTON MILL) CEMETERY

Sec. C. Cons. Grave 18042.

United Kingdom

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of William George and Louisa Kate Blake; husband of Mabel Beatrice Blake, of Crownhill, Plymouth.
  • Personal Inscription DARLING HUSBAND OF MABEL AND DEAR DAD OF BILL AND MONTY. TILL WE MEET AGAIN R.I.P.
